Colin Brumby- Suite for Four Double Basses

In this new recording of Colin Brumby’s suite, Australian double bassist Jeremy Watt covers all four lines himself, and in doing so creates the ideal consort, blending four parts from one instrument seamlessly. Currently a member of the City of Birmingham Symphony Orchestra and a visiting teacher in chamber music at the Royal Birmingham Conservatoire, Jeremy has an avid interest in ensemble playing. Some of his future releases on Luminate Records will explore chamber music repertoire of other instruments, in new arrangements featuring the unique timbre of an all double bass setting.

Brumby’s Suite for Four Double Basses is published by Yorke Edition.
